Hybrid Positron Emission Tomography (PET) Systems Market Segmentation and Market Companies

Segments

- By Product: The hybrid positron emission tomography (PET) systems market can be segmented by product type into full-ring PET systems, and partial-ring PET systems. Full-ring PET systems are expected to dominate the market due to their higher accuracy and better image quality compared to partial-ring PET systems.
- By Application: In terms of application, the market can be segmented into oncology, cardiology, neurology, and other applications. Oncology is projected to be the leading application segment, driven by the rising incidence of cancer worldwide and the need for accurate imaging techniques for cancer diagnosis and treatment.
- By End-User: The end-user segmentation of the market includes hospitals, diagnostic centers, and research institutions. Hospitals are anticipated to be the largest end-user segment due to the high patient footfall for various diagnostic procedures and treatments.

The hybrid positron emission tomography (PET) systems market is a dynamic and competitive landscape with key players continually striving to innovate and meet the evolving needs of healthcare providers and patients. One of the emerging trends in the market is the increasing focus on personalized medicine and targeted therapies, driving the demand for advanced imaging technologies that can provide precise and detailed diagnostic information. This trend is leading to the development of PET systems with improved sensitivity and resolution, enabling healthcare professionals to better visualize and characterize diseases at the molecular level.

Another significant trend shaping the market is the integration of artificial intelligence (AI) and machine learning algorithms into PET imaging processes. These technologies are revolutionizing PET image interpretation by enhancing diagnostic accuracy, identifying subtle abnormalities, and improving overall patient outcomes. By leveraging AI capabilities, healthcare providers can streamline image analysis, reduce interpretation errors, and optimize treatment planning for better patient care.

Furthermore, there is a growing emphasis on research and development activities to enhance the capabilities of hybrid PET systems. Market players are investing in novel technologies such as time-of-flight (TOF) PET imaging, which improves image quality and lesion detectability by capturing the timing of annihilation events more accurately. Additionally, advancements in detector technology, software algorithms, and image reconstruction techniques are driving the development of next-generation PET systems that offer faster scan times, lower radiation doses, and enhanced image resolution.
